Having focused your studies and internships on industrial engineering, when did you start to dedicate yourself to communications?
My first contact with Marketing and Communication was in my first job, at the Unión Fenosa Energy Efficiency Centre in Madrid . From the first day, I was in charge of the energy efficiency campaigns that the Centre was developing internally and externally, as well as generating content for the creation of competitions, energy efficiency guides, and energy savings calculation tools… that’s how it all began.

What does your job as head of internal and external communications at EnergyLab entail?
My job at EnergyLab as Head of Communication is very broad, as we are 26 employees in total and we all have to work hard to definitively consolidate the center. The tasks of our area range from the management of social networks and the website on a daily basis, the organization of events, the creation of content and new materials for branding, dissemination activities for the R&D&I projects developed by the center (conferences, project website and its specific social networks, dissemination materials, coordination of the tasks of the project partners, etc.) , development of dissemination articles in the press and specialized magazines, monitoring and definition of the Communication Plan, and development and creation of training courses, which fall within the Communication area, having to manage an e-learning platform for the development of technical online courses.
